dc.description.abstractWe develop the theory of electrohydrodynamic instability in nematic liquid crystals by incorporating the flexoelectric terms. Using a one-dimensional linear analysis of the problem for an applied DC field, we demonstrate that for the usual materials the rolls have an oblique orientation as has been found experimentally. We also provide an experimental evidence for the strong flexoelectric influence on the director profile in the rolls.en
